    I really miss Alice, which is tucked away behind the Boogie Wonderland club. They serve Mad Hatter cocktails in teapots! You could also check out Monsoon Poon, which is an Asian/Indian fusion restaurant. They have a great happy hour deal on the cocktail of the week from 4-6 PM, and the atmosphere is hip and fun. If you're more of a beer person than a cocktail drinker, definitely head to Mac's Brewery on the waterfront.     Yes! Despite the long line, the Anne Frank House is worth the visit. Remain patient and try to go early in the morning. What was once a distant memory from middle school assigned reading quickly becomes reality once you step foot into the dark hiding places of this young girl.     Prices can depend on whether it is high season or weekend/midweek. Harbor House Inn is a really nice decently priced hotel that does not have a pool, but the beach is a block away.     Portland Parish is a leading agricultural area of the country, and tends to be less touristy than some of the other parts of Jamaica. Go there for quiet, beautiful beaches, and lots of caves and waterfalls to explore. More
